Question to the Department for Science, Innovation & Technology:

To ask His Majesty's Government what steps they are taking to prevent the abuse of the UK design register by traders registering invalid old designs to maliciously block competitors on online marketplaces; and what consideration they have given to reintroducing substantive examination or the use of artificial intelligence search tools to identify invalid applications prior to registration.

The government is aware that some applicants are abusing the UK design system and seeking to register designs for well-known products or products that don’t belong to them.

The 2025 consultation on changes to the UK design framework sought views on a wide range of measures around search and examination to improve the validity of registered designs. The government is currently reviewing responses to the consultation, and a response will be issued later this year.
